So I have a question, I have been having issues recently, the problem that I have is as follows.
I have 4 monitors, Main: Acer predator 27 inch xb271hu 165hz 1440p G-Sync Monitor, A 27 inc Acer xf240h 144hz monitor, and a Asus vg248qe 24 inch 144hz monitor, and a AOC 60hz 27 inch monitor.
I have been using this without any problems what so ever before, but just recently I started having problems in games with tearing/stuttering. I have set my main G sync monitor to my primary monitor, I have the latest nvidia drivers, (tried earlier ones aswell) I have G sync enabled in NVCP In fullscreen mode, I have all my monitors refresh rates set at their highest, I have G-Sync/V sync ON in global settings, I have capped my FPS in NVCP at 162/160/150/140 with same results, I get tearing/stuttering either way, specially with CSGO, where I now also can feel a huge amount of delay when moving around aswell as the stutter/tearing, wich was never there before. I even reinstalled windows to be sure without any success. I have also tried without V-SYNC, Only G sync, same results. I have no clue what the problem can be, any help would be HUGELY appriciated. and I would even go as far as paying if I could get this problem resolved one way or another, I’am a competitve gamer, wich really need to be able to play, since I have a team I play for etc, so I’am desperate to get this working somehow
System information : GPU GTX 1080 TI , CPU I7 8700K 32GB G-skill trident-z 3200mhz ram. 1000W PSU.
